4.  Stack and Slash Twin Quilt:

     * Collect 16 different, 11 inch cuts of fabric.  You will want a variety of light, dark, and medium colors.  An easy way to do this is to choose 4 colors you want in the quilt.  Of these 4 fabrics you will choose ONE LIGHT, ONE DARK, AND TWO MEDIUMS.  Also, try to vary the size and scale of the prints.  NOTE:  having different shades of fabric and variety of print sizes, adds depth, texture, and interest in your quilt.  

     * 2 yards for the bias binding OR
     * 2 yards for piquet binding
     * For the back- one twin flat sheet, ($3.00? at Wal-Mart)
     * Two spools of high quality thread, Gutermann, Dual Duty, or Mettler.

     *Optional- 1/2 yard fabric to make quilo, (blanket tucks into pouch to make a pillow

      (provided- 2 yards of 96" batting)
